Find the Local Maxima and Minima f(x)=x^4-50x^2+625
Problem
Solution
Find the first derivative of the function to identify critical points.
Set the derivative to zero and solve for
x to find the critical values.
Find the second derivative to apply the Second Derivative Test for concavity.
Evaluate the second derivative at each critical point to determine if it is a maximum or minimum.
Interpret the results of the test:
ƒ(0)″<0 indicates a local maximum, whileƒ(5)″>0 andƒ″*(−5)>0 indicate local minima.
Calculate the function values at these points to find the coordinates.
